Mailbox is approaching its limit.

Got an email from 'Admin' just now telling me that my mailbox is approaching its limit. I've cleared my emails as much as possible. Is it possible to see now how much of my email quota is used? Before deleting emails; Quota Type: bytes in the mailbox Quota Available: 11531686 Total Quota: 31457280 TIA

Re: Mailbox is approaching its limit.

In webmail click on Options then Index Order
You should see Size with Add beside it
Click on Add
Go back to Inbox
Each mail will have the size beside it.
When you open Thunderbird any mail in webmail
will be downloaded to Thunderbird, emptying your
mailbox unless you have it set to leave a copy on the
server which I doubt given you had no mails when you
logged into webmail.
If the mailbox almost full limit mesage came from VM you possibly
had a large email sitting in webmail but hadn't yet opened
Thunderbird prompting the mail from VM.
You fixed it by opening Thunderbird and retrieving mail.
